APA Zoning Practice July 2023: “Using Faith-Based Land for Affordable Housing”

The July issue of the American Planning Association Zoning Practice, “Using Faith-Based Land for Affordable Housing,” is authored by Clarion’s Donald Elliott, FAICP, and Maggie Squyer.

As described in the article, “This issue of Zoning Practice explores the growing trend of developing transitional and permanent affordable housing on underused faith-based land. It examines the relationship between land supply and the housing crisis, the reasons why religious institutions are increasingly interested in development partnerships, and the zoning standards that can limit development opportunities. And it highlights several successful efforts to bring new affordable housing to faith-based lands.”
